A presente obra surge na sequência da tese de mestrado anteriormente publicada, representando um aprofundamento no estudo e investigação, atualizado e orientado pela nova legislação nacional e internacional, pautado pela experiência de observação e acompanhamento de casos de elevado conflito parental. Tem em vista contribuir para a comunidade jurídica com elementos ou ferramentas que permitam melhor e mais profunda compreensão desta temática tão sensível, que permita promover uma melhor aplicação do direito. Casos de elevado conflito não se solucionam com vagas ideias sobre o tema - exigem do operador do direito um estudo profundo e empenhado e multidisciplinar. Somente a norma jurídica não tem o condão de solucionar questões tão complexas e subjetivas, dado que a base do comportamento antijurídico em causa é puramente emocional. Impondo, desse modo, a necessidade de um olhar cuidado fazendo o paralelo entre o direito e a psicologia/psicanálise para compreender os tipos de conflito e as suas dinâmicas. Dessa forma será possível adequar a aplicação do direito e operar mudanças positivas para que as crianças continuem a ter família para além da separação dos pais. A adequada solução dos casos passa, hoje, por investimento na formação e mudança da cultura e atuação profissional, com necessária cooperação entre diferentes operadores do direito e diferentes saberes, libertando-nos dos dogmas.

A alienação parental é um tema muito controverso que não reúne consensos na comunidade jurídica e científica. Porém, e independentemente do cunho que se lhe atribui, o comportamento parental de interferência negativa na manutenção ou estabelecimento dos laços num movimento de busca pela relação de exclusividade da convivência e afecto é uma realidade inegável de muitas famílias e, consequentemente, dos tribunais, com todos os prejuízos que representa para o harmonioso desenvolvimento das crianças e prossecução dos seus direitos e dignidade. De modo que o presente livro representa o trabalho de investigação de doutoramento em Direito, sempre com uma abordagem e reflexão multidisciplinar e crítica sobre a alienação parental e a necessária distinção de figuras afins com as quais se cruza mas não confunde. Assim como uma premente necessidade de fomentar a reflexão crítica sobre a actuação judiciária, visando promover o aprofundamento do tema e mudanças de paradigma da actuação dos operadores judiciários diante casos de alienação parental, a sua correcta identificação e multiplicidade de soluções possíveis.

Parental alienation is an important phenomenon that mental health professionals should know about and thoroughly understand, especially those who work with children, adolescents, divorced adults, and adults whose parents divorced when they were children. In this book, the authors define parental alienation as a mental condition in which a child - usually one whose parents are engaged in a high- conflict divorce - allies himself or herself strongly with one parent (the preferred parent) and rejects a relationship with the other parent (the alienated parent) without legitimate justification. This process leads to a tragic outcome when the child and the alienated parent, who previously had a loving and mutually satisfying relationship, lose the nurture and joy of that relationship for many years and perhaps for their lifetimes. We estimate that 1 percent of children and adolescents in the U.S. experience parental alienation. When the phenomenon is properly recognized, this condition is preventable and treatable in many instances. The authors of this book believe that parental alienation is not simply a minor aberration in the life of a family, but a serious mental condition. Because of the false belief that the alienated parent is a dangerous or unworthy person, the child loses one of the most important relationships in his or her life. This book contains much information about the validity, reliability, and prevalence of parental alienation. It also includes a comprehensive international bibliography regarding parental alienation with more than 600 citations. In order to bring life to the definitions and the technical writing, several short clinical vignettes have been included. These vignettes are based on actual families and real events, but have been modified to protect the privacy of both the parents and children.

It's never too late to have a good divorce Based on two decades of groundbreaking research, The Good Divorce presents the surprising finding that in more than fifty percent of divorces couples end their marriages, yet preserve their families. Dr. Ahrons shows couples how they can move beyond the confusing, even terrifying early stages of breakup and learn to deal with the transition from a nuclear to a "binuclear" family--one that spans two households and continues to meet the needs of children. The Good Divorce makes an important contribution to the ongoing "family values" debate by dispelling the myth that divorce inevitability leaves emotionally troubles children in its wake. It is a powerful tonic for the millions of divorcing and long-divorces parents who are tired of hearing only the damage reports. It will make us change the way we think about divorce and the way we divorce, reconfirming our commitment to children and families.

This volume analyzes the effectiveness of the judicial protection of children's rights within the Council of Europe. The extent to which common standards have been developed by the courts in implementing children's rights is examined both from the perspective of the European Court of Human Rights and the judgments of the highest national courts within the member states of the Council of Europe. Further analysis is made of the Council of Europe's Social Charter and the reports of the European Committee for the Prevention of Torture and Inhuman or Degrading Treatment or Punishment.--Publisher's description
